Analysis

Burkina Faso recorded 166,087 for population ages 65-69, female in 2025. That is the highest value across all 66 years on record.

That represents a change of up 3.7% on the previous year and up 37.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, population ages 65-69, female in Burkina Faso peaked at 166,087 in 2025 and was at its lowest, 30,751, in 1960.

That places Burkina Faso 86th out of 217 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 66 years of available data.
